工作職責
1、全棧研發(fā)交付:參與需求拆解、技術(shù)方案、開發(fā)實現(xiàn)、聯(lián)調(diào)測試、上線與缺陷修復(前后端均覆蓋)。
2、前端開發(fā):基于 Vue3/React 完成業(yè)務頁面、組件封裝、表單交互、權(quán)限態(tài)渲染與性能優(yōu)化。
3、后端開發(fā):基于 Java Spring Boot(或 Node.js/NestJS)實現(xiàn) RESTful API、業(yè)務邏輯、數(shù)據(jù)訪問層、異常與日志體系;支持接口文檔與聯(lián)調(diào)規(guī)范。
4、智能化能力接入:對接大模型 API/私有模型服務,完成知識庫構(gòu)建、Embedding、向量檢索、RAG 鏈路與服務化封裝,保障可觀測與可回歸測試。
5、部署與運維交付:Linux 環(huán)境部署、Nginx、Docker、CI/CD(如 Jenkins)、日志排障;支持內(nèi)網(wǎng)/私有化部署與必要的國產(chǎn)化環(huán)境適配。
任職要求
1、2 年及以上 Web 全?;蚝蠖?前端實戰(zhàn)經(jīng)驗,能獨立完成模塊交付與聯(lián)調(diào)
2、良好的工程化習慣:需求澄清、任務拆分、代碼評審、可維護性與文檔意識
3、Vue3 / React 其一熟練;熟悉 TypeScript、路由、狀態(tài)管理、組件化開發(fā)
4、熟悉常用 UI 框架(Element Plus / Ant Design 等)與表單/列表類中后臺模式
5、Java:Spring Boot / Spring MVC / MyBatis(或同類 ORM),能設計并實現(xiàn)穩(wěn)定 API 與業(yè)務服務;或 Node.js:NestJS/Express 等,具備同等工程化能力
6、數(shù)據(jù)庫:MySQL/PostgreSQL 其一熟練(表結(jié)構(gòu)設計、索引優(yōu)化、復雜查詢)
7、緩存與中間件:Redis 基礎能力;了解 MQ(Kafka/RabbitMQ)優(yōu)先
8、熟悉 Linux、Nginx、Docker、Git;能完成部署、回滾、日志定位與基礎性能排查
9、熟悉 CI/CD 基本流程(如 Jenkins/自動化構(gòu)建發(fā)布)
加分項:
? 有政企/事業(yè)單位系統(tǒng)交付經(jīng)驗,理解等保類要求;
? 有國產(chǎn)化、信創(chuàng)適配經(jīng)驗:國產(chǎn)OS、國產(chǎn)數(shù)據(jù)庫、中間件、兼容性與部署改造;
? 有大模型應用工程經(jīng)驗:RAG、向量數(shù)據(jù)庫(Milvus、pgvector 等)、LangChain、類似框架、鏈路可觀測與評估。